index.wxml 3.4 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687
  1. <!--pages/clock/clock-tongji/index.wxml-->
  2. <wxs src="../clock.wxs" module="clock"></wxs>
  3. <view class="container">
  4. <view class="header" bindtap="toList">
  5. <view class="header-title">
  6. <text>{{mouth}}月汇总</text>
  7. <image src="{{imgServerUrl}}/images/clock/clock-arrow-righr-disabled.png"></image>
  8. </view>
  9. <view class="header-content">
  10. <view class="header-content-items">
  11. <view class="number">{{clock.toFixed(currentSettlement.nextMoney)}}</view>
  12. <view class="name">总预支(元)</view>
  13. </view>
  14. <view class="header-content-items">
  15. <view class="number">{{clock.toFixed(currentSettlement.countDuration)}}</view>
  16. <view class="name">总工时(小时)</view>
  17. </view>
  18. <view class="header-content-items">
  19. <view class="number">{{clock.toFixed(currentSettlement.lackClock)}}</view>
  20. <view class="name">缺卡(次)</view>
  21. </view>
  22. </view>
  23. </view>
  24. <view class="calendar-content">
  25. <view class="calendar-content-header">
  26. <view>月统计数据</view>
  27. <view class="calendar-content-choose">
  28. <view class="last" bindtap="last">
  29. <image src="{{last}}"></image>
  30. </view>
  31. <text class="calendar-content-choose-text">{{text}}月</text>
  32. <view class="next" bindtap="next">
  33. <image src="{{next}}"></image>
  34. </view>
  35. </view>
  36. </view>
  37. <calendar class="calendar" list="{{wsPunchClockList}}" bind:day='day' />
  38. </view>
  39. <view class="clock-detail">
  40. <view class="titps">
  41. <view>请根据企业实际上下班时间打卡</view>
  42. <view>今日打卡{{punckClockList.length}}次,工时{{currentDuration}}小时</view>
  43. </view>
  44. <view class="clock" wx:if='{{punckClockList.length}}'>
  45. <view class="clock-content" wx:for="{{punckClockList}}" wx:key='index'>
  46. <view class="left">
  47. <view class="top" wx:if="{{item.clockType === 1}}"></view>
  48. <block wx:else>
  49. <view class="midden"></view>
  50. <view class="bottom"></view>
  51. </block>
  52. </view>
  53. <view class="right">
  54. <view class="clock-in" wx:if="{{item.clockType === 1}}">
  55. <view class="clock-type">上班 {{item.punchClock}}</view>
  56. <view class="address">
  57. <image src="{{imgServerUrl}}/images/clock/clock-position.png" class="position"></image>
  58. <text>{{item.companyName}}</text>
  59. </view>
  60. </view>
  61. <view class="clock-out" wx:if="{{item.clockType === 2}}">
  62. <view class="clock-type">下班 {{item.punchClock}}</view>
  63. <view class="address">
  64. <image src="{{imgServerUrl}}/images/clock/clock-position.png" class="position"></image>
  65. <text>{{item.companyName}}</text>
  66. </view>
  67. </view>
  68. <view class="clock-out" wx:if="{{item.clockType === 3}}">
  69. <view class="clock-type">下班<text class="shortage">缺卡</text></view>
  70. <view class="address">
  71. <image src="{{imgServerUrl}}/images/clock/clock-position.png" class="position"></image>
  72. <text>{{item.companyName}}</text>
  73. </view>
  74. </view>
  75. </view>
  76. </view>
  77. </view>
  78. <view class="nextMoney">
  79. <view class="nextMoney-message">当日可预支工资:</view>
  80. <view class="money">
  81. <text>{{nextMoney}}</text>
  82. <text>元</text>
  83. </view>
  84. </view>
  85. </view>
  86. </view>